There are only a handful of fighters who have a persona like Conor McGregor. Aside from being one of the most popular fighters in the entire promotion, McGregor is a real threat to any and all fighters in the Lightweight division. His rivalry with Nate Diaz has been etched in the UFC history books as one of the greatest ever.

Currently, the whole world is talking about Nate Diaz taking on Jake Paul in a boxing match. Ariel Helwani from Matchroom Boxing had to get McGregor’s opinion on his former division rival and his upcoming match-up. What he said might come as a shocker to most people.

A sit down with Conor McGregor & Ariel Helwani

McGregor has always been, in a more positive sense of the word, brazen. He knows what happens in the ring, stays in the ring. When asked about Nate Diaz and their newly discovered sense of camaraderie, the former UFC champion said, “You know it’s competitive, but it’s always been respect.“. “How could you not respect the Diaz brothers and their resume in the fight camp.” he added. 

A rivalry like theirs, you would assume, would continue for ages. However, both Diaz and McGregor were able to set that aside and come out in support of each other. Talking about Nate Diaz, he continues, “Real Fighters.. Thats his promotion Real Fighters Inc. or something like that. You know, great fighter. I’ve spent 40 minutes in the cage with the lad. It’s always going to be respect off of that.

Looking back on a fight against Nate Diaz, Conor couldn’t help but appreciate Diaz’s tremendous courage and will power. “Gave me the rematch in an instant – that’s commendable, that’s real warrior stuff.” said the Irishman, recalling an incident where Diaz gave Conor a rematch shot after defeating the Irish.

Diaz vs. Paul – A fan favourite fight, coming soon

Fans of combat sports couldn’t be more thrilled as YouTuber-turned-Boxer Jake Paul goes toe-to-toe with former UFC fighter Nate Diaz. This isn’t the first time UFC fighters have squared up against boxers. Nate Diaz’s ex-rival and former UFC Champion Conor McGregor had gotten in the ring with the legendary boxer Floyd Mayweather Jr. He lost the bout but did win a round. Needless to say, McGregor has showed his support for his former rival saying “Nate Diaz slaps the head off [Jake Paul] and I look forward to seeing it.“.

The match could swing both ways, and any sort of prediction looks difficult. However, the opinion of a decorated fighter like McGregor has to carry some weight. The match is scheduled for August 5, 2023, and it is destined to be a nail-biter.
